2 qq 34362017 qq_34362017 于 2016.04.18 14:27 提问

Java分页功能的实现+数据库

求一个java分页的demo,有数据库,加前台的那种。谢谢了

3个回答

CSDNXIAOS
CSDNXIAOS   2016.04.18 14:33

package swing.login;

import java.util.Vector;
//传入一个大的集合,取出一个小的集合
public class PageController {
private Vector<Vector<String>> bigv ;//定义一个大的集合,装载传过来的所有数据
private Vector<Vect......
答案就在这里:java中实现分页功能
----------------------Hi,地球人,我是问答机器人小S,上面的内容就是我狂拽酷炫叼炸天的答案,除了赞同,你还有别的选择吗?

xiaoyao880609
xiaoyao880609   2016.04.18 14:48

前台分页可以使用插件,也可以根据总数据量和每页的数量自己做。
后台数据库分页根据数据库不同写法也不一样。
mysql 比较简单可以直接用limit index,count分页查询。
oracle每页提供分页sql,可以通过rounum字段通过子查询实现分页。
前端需要往后台传递当前页和每页显示数量。
最好自己封装将数据库中返回的list中的对象继承基类。父类中封装方法返回第几个开始获取多少条的方法。
将分页算法封装起来。以便服用。
具体代码就不写了。我只把实现逻辑说一下。具体实现的时候哪块不明白现百度,要养成凡是问百度或谷歌。
不要一心想着依赖人,那样对你的成长是有限的。趁年轻要多努力。
加油~ 相信没有程序猿实现不了的,只要给足够时间都可以实现,因为世上有百度,谷歌等靠山~

u010850027
u010850027   2016.04.18 19:47
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!